目录:
- 1、如何在MySQL中的获取IP地址的网段
- 2、mysql 中怎样查询 ip ?
- 3、【已解决】MYSQL的IP地址在那里看?
- 4、mysql主机地址是什么????下面的该怎么添??
- 5、MYSQL服务器地址是什么意思?
- 6、如何配置 msql数据库 公网ip地址
如何在MySQL中的获取IP地址的网段
效果展示:通过下面的命令可以快速的获取IP地址的网段
命令解释:
inet_aton('209.207.224.1')这个函数是将IP地址转化为一个序列.
convert是将序列类型定义成整数.
0xFFFFFF00的意思是与FFFFFF00这个16进制数进行与操作.这步操作相当于掩码.可以过滤网段.
inet_ntoa这个函数是将整理好的序列转化成IP地址的形式.
mysql 中怎样查询 ip ?
怎么感觉你的写法总是怪怪的?
你存入数据库后,查看一下,你确定有存入数据库么?
如果没有存入数据库,就是你前面那句存入语句的问题了。
如果是我写,我会这么写:
$sql="insert
into
count(ipaddr)
values('"$visitip"')";
查询的:
$sql="select
*
from
count
where
ipaddr
like
'%"$key"%'";
我两年前学的PHP,但因为那时很难找PHP空间,结果就不了了之了。。。
不懂上面我写的有没有错,有错请指正,在我的评论中帮我指正,谢谢了~!
【已解决】MYSQL的IP地址在那里看?
在主机管理中的MySQL点击你要查询的Mysql的图标,进入后可以看到该数据库的详细信息主机管理中我都没有看到“Mysql的图标”啊,请问是在哪里啊?可否截个图瞅瞅,原谅一下,我菜鸟。
mysql主机地址是什么????下面的该怎么添??
mysql主机地址是什么????下面的该怎么添??
答:
SQLyog
Enterprise
中,mysql的主机地址如果你是本机,就填写localhost,如果不是本机就需要填写那个mysql服务器的IP地址;
用户名,如果是你自己本机,就可以用root,而不是本机就需要用对方给你的特定用户名;
密码,你自己本机的话,就是你自己安装的时候所设置的那个密码,不是本机就需要用对方给你那个用户的对应密码。
端口不管是不是本机,都是固定端口3306;
数据库,如果是本机,且是用的root账号,那么可以省略不填写,而如果不是root账号,就需要用那个用户所拥有的数据库权限的那个数据库名;
如果不是本机,那么就是用对方给你的账号密码和数据库,你就输入那数据库名就OK了。
MYSQL服务器地址是什么意思?
MYSQL中的服务器地址就是服务器的IP地址。
如图所示,其中标红位置就是服务器地址的填写位置,一般可写主机名称或IP地址。
IP地址是指互联网协议地址(英语:Internet Protocol Address,又译为网际协议地址),是IP Address的缩写。IP地址是IP协议提供的一种统一的地址格式,它为互联网上的每一个网络和每一台主机分配一个逻辑地址,以此来屏蔽物理地址的差异。
如何配置 msql数据库 公网ip地址
/etc/mysql/my.cnf
找到 bind-address =127.0.0.1 将其注释掉;//作用是使得不再只允许本地访问;
重启mysql:/etc/init.d/mysql restart;
2:登录mysql数据库:mysql -u root -p
mysql use mysql;
查询host值:
mysql select user,host from user;
如果没有"%"这个host值,就执行下面这两句:
mysql update user set host='%' where user='root';
mysql flush privileges;
或者也可以执行:
mysqlgrand all privileges on *.* to root@'%' identifies by ' xxxx';
其中 第一个*表示数据库名;第二个*表示该数据库的表名;如果像上面那样 *.*的话表示所有到数据库下到所有表都允许访问;
‘%':表示允许访问到mysql的ip地址;当然你也可以配置为具体到ip名称;%表示所有ip均可以访问;
后面到‘xxxx'为root 用户的password;
评论前必须登录!
注册